Wandsworth Common Care Home offers a complete luxury experience that can only be truly appreciated through an in-person visit. This spectacular purpose-built care home comprises 97 private apartments spanning five floors, extending a warm welcome to couples or companions continuing their care journey together. Each apartment has en-suite wet rooms and a spacious kitchenette, catering to individuals needing residential respite, dementia care, or nursing care.

Funding & Fees

Weekly Charges per Person

Type of carePermanentRespite
Residential CareFrom £2,000From £2,100
Residential Dementia CareFrom £2,300From £2,400
Nursing CareFrom £2,200From £2,300
Nursing Dementia CareFrom £2,400From £2,500

All prices are fixed, regardless of care.

Support you may be entitled to

  • If you chose a care home based in England, you may be eligible for NHS Funded Nursing Care (FNC), which helps cover the cost of nursing. This is worth £267.68 per week and is usually paid directly to the care home.

Review from Peter S (Nephew of Resident) published on 16 December 2025 Submitted via Website
Overall Experience
My aunt was becoming unable to look after herself at her house so my wife searched for a suitable care home. She found the Wandsworth Common Care Home (WCCH) and after a visit we were sure that this would be ideal for my aunt. It was unlike any other care home we had ever been in - more like an upmarket hotel.
My aunt was not sure she was ready for a care home but after a further fall, and the offer of a month's trial she said yes. I have photographs of her on the day she arrived - still anxious from her previous life - and then 10 days later, totally relaxed and happy. She spent 9 glorious months in her beautiful apartment, but unfortunately, she had a severe stroke, and after spending time in hospital she was able to return to WCCH but she sadly passed away one week later.

What makes WCCH different is the beautiful environment but especially the staff who go above and beyond on so many occasions. They became a family to Joyce we always knew she was happy and well looked after.

Review from Michael W (Son of Resident) published on 19 May 2025 Submitted via Website
Overall Experience

Dad (90) has now been here for a couple of months, and we all think the place is amazing. As our daughter, 16, marvelled: "this place doesn't feel like a care home". No, it is much nicer than that. The building looks like a yellow submarine from the outside, but inside it has the airy, luxurious feel of a grand hotel. Some of the same animation, too.

We very much enjoy our visits. Dad is full of praise for his carers, and it is heartening often to find him - a very shy man - chatting happily with others in the cafe or courtyard when we arrive, unannounced. Someone is quietly making the effort to see that this happens.

There are some lovely activities. The nursing care is on-the-ball, and we are all struck the wonderfully upbeat atmosphere that seems to run through the building. Dad loves being able to help himself to treats from the cafe; to have a glass of wine with supper; to invite us to join him for lunch. We feel blessed, and cannot imagine a better place for him.
